Description/Taste
Black pepper is botanically known as Piper nigrum and the peppercorns are the spice of the flowering vine pepper plant. The pepper plant grows as a vine that produces small white flowers. These flowers after 3 to 4 years develop into the berry known as the peppercorn spice. Black peppercorns are small berries that develop a black outer covering when mature. Black peppercorns have a pungent flavor and a slight heat.
